当前位置:首页 > app小程序 > 正文

*** 敏捷开发,***敏捷开发

大家好,今天小编关注到一个比较有意思的话题,就是关于app 敏捷开发问题,于是小编就整理了3个相关介绍APP 敏捷开发的解答,让我们一起看看吧。

  1. 什么是敏捷开发?
  2. 如何提高APP组织可行性的管理能力?
  3. teambition敏捷开发使用教程?

什么是敏捷开发?

敏捷开发又称敏捷软件开发, 是一种从1990年代开始逐渐引起广泛关注的一些新型软件开发方法,是一种应对快速变化的需求的一种软件开发能力。它们的具体名称、理念、过程、术语都不 尽相同,相对于“非敏捷”,更强调程序员团队业务专家之间的紧密协作、面对面的沟通(认为比书面的文档更有效)、频繁交付新的软件版本、紧凑而自我组织 型的团队、能够很好地适应需求变化的代码编写和团队组织方法,也更注重软件开发中人的作用。

人和交互 重于过程和工具

app 敏捷开发,app敏捷开发
图片来源网络,侵删)

可以工作的软件 重于求全而完备的文档。

客户协作重于合同谈判。

随时应对变化重于循规蹈矩。

app 敏捷开发,app敏捷开发
(图片来源网络,侵删)

其中位于右边的内容虽然也有其价值,但是左边的内容最为重要。人员彼此信任 人少但是精干 可以面对面的沟通项目的敏捷开发:敏捷开发小组主要的工作方式可以归纳为:作为一个整体工作; 按短迭代周期工作; 每次迭代交付一些成果; 关注业务优先级; 检查与调整。最重要的因素恐怕是项目的规模。规模增长,面对面的沟通就愈加困难,因此敏捷方法更适用于较小的队伍,40、30、20、10人或者更少。大规模的敏捷软件开发尚处于积极研究的领域

如何提高***组织可行性管理能力?

提高***组织可行性的管理能力需要从以下几个方面入手:
制定明确的目标和规划:在***开发之前,需要明确组织的目标和规划,包括***的功能定位用户群体、市场前景等。这有助于组织在开发过程中保持清晰的方向和目标,提高管理效率。
建立有效的团队和沟通机制:一个高效的开发团队是***成功的重要保障。需要建立良好的沟通机制,包括有效的团队沟通、及时反馈和协调合作等。同时,需要明确团队成员的职责和分工,确保每个成员都能够发挥自己的优势,提高整体效率。
制定详细的项目计划时间表:在***开发过程中,需要制定详细的项目***和时间表,明确每个阶段任务、时间节点和负责人。这有助于组织对开发进程进行有效的监控和管理,及时发现和解决问题。
注重用户反馈和需求分析:在***开发过程中,需要密切关注用户反馈和需求分析,及时调整和完善***的功能和体验。同时,需要了解用户的使用习惯和需求,从用户角度出发,优化***的设计和功能。
引入敏捷开发方法:敏捷开发方法是一种灵活、快速、高效的软件开发方法。通过引入敏捷开发方法,可以更好地应对需求变化和反馈,提高开发效率和产品质量。
加强风险管理:***开发过程中存在各种风险,如技术风险、市场风险、竞争风险等。需要加强风险管理,制定风险应对策略,及时发现和处理风险问题。
持续学习和改进:***开发是一个持续学习和改进的过程。需要关注行业动态和市场变化,学习其他成功***的经验和做法,不断优化和完善自己的***。
通过以上措施,可以提高***组织可行性的管理能力,提高开发效率和产品质量,提升组织的竞争力和市场适应能力。

teambition敏捷开发使用教程

一、用任务板管理产品需求 在scrum项目中,ProductOwner创建productbacklog的任务分组,为其划分阶段,用来收集产品需求和用户故事,并按照优先级进行排列。

app 敏捷开发,app敏捷开发
(图片来源网络,侵删)

二、用任务分组安排开发排期 研发团队用sprintbacklog的任务分组,来进行工作量的预估和安排。 通过Sprint***会议,PO从ProductBacklog中选出需求点作为本次迭代的目标,将其移动到SprintBacklog中。

到此,以上就是小编对于*** 敏捷开发的问题就介绍到这了,希望介绍关于*** 敏捷开发的3点解答对大家有用。